Product Description
The CMT Contractor Cove and Fillet Bit is a precision-crafted router bit designed to bring classic elegance to furniture, cabinetry, and decorative woodworking projects. Combining a traditional cove cut with a fillet cut in a single pass, this bit produces an eye-catching two-part profile that elevates edge treatments from ordinary to refined. With a 1" diameter, 1/2" cutting height, and 3/16" radius, it delivers clean, consistent results on solid hardwood, softwood, and sheet goods alike. The 1/4" shank makes it compatible with a wide range of handheld routers and router tables, giving woodworkers the flexibility to use it in multiple setups.

Frequently Asked Questions
What type of profile does this bit produce?
This bit combines a traditional cove cut with a fillet cut in a single pass, creating a two-part decorative edge profile. The cove portion is a concave curved cut with a 3/16" radius, while the fillet adds a flat step detail that gives the overall edge a more layered, elegant appearance - commonly used on furniture rails, cabinet doors, and decorative moulding.
Will this bit work with my handheld router?
Yes. The 1/4" shank is compatible with the vast majority of handheld routers and router tables that accept standard 1/4" collets. It can also be used in CNC routing setups that accept 1/4" tooling.
Does the anti-kickback design limit how I use the bit?
The anti-kickback design controls the maximum depth of cut per pass rather than limiting the overall profile achievable. It is a safety feature that reduces the likelihood of sudden material grab or kickback, particularly useful when routing hardwoods or making freehand passes. The full cove and fillet profile is still achievable in normal operation.
What materials can I rout with this bit?
The carbide-tipped cutting edges and heat-treated body make this bit suitable for use in solid hardwood, softwood, plywood, and MDF. The two-tooth carbide construction is well suited for a range of wood-based materials commonly used in furniture and cabinetry work.
